Understanding Various Paint Finishes



Choosing the appropriate paint finish for your walls calls for a clear understanding of the different types readily available and their details characteristics. Repaint finishes can considerably influence the total look and feel of a space, so it is crucial to choose sensibly.

One common kind of paint coating is flat/matte. This finish has a smooth, non-reflective appearance, making it perfect for hiding blemishes on walls. Nonetheless, flat/matte surfaces are less sturdy and can be challenging to tidy.



One more preferred choice is eggshell/satin surface. This coating uses a refined sheen and is extra cleanable than flat/matte coatings, making it appropriate for areas that call for constant cleaning.

For a slightly glossier appearance, consider a semi-gloss surface. This surface is durable, easy to clean, and adds a refined luster to the walls, making it a wonderful choice for kitchens, restrooms, and trim work.

Finally, high-gloss surfaces provide a highly reflective, practically glass-like look. These surfaces are very long lasting and very easy to tidy, but they tend to highlight imperfections on the walls.

Professional Tips for Perfect Wall Finishes



To attain remarkable wall finishes, it is important to comply with skilled suggestions that ensure a specialist and sleek search in your area.

First of all, appropriate preparation is vital. Fill up any kind of openings or splits, sand rough surfaces, and tidy the wall surfaces extensively before repainting to ensure a smooth base for the paint application.

Second of all, invest in premium paint and tools. Quality paints not just provide much better protection and resilience but additionally cause a much more refined finish. Likewise, using good brushes and rollers can make a significant distinction in the final outcome.

Furthermore, always begin by cutting in the edges with a brush before using a roller for the major surface areas. This method aids develop crisp lines and stays clear of visible brush marks on the bigger locations.

Furthermore, preserving a wet edge while painting is important to stop lap marks.

Finally, apply several thin coats instead of one thick layer to accomplish an extra even and professional-looking surface.
